Tata Trusts, which has been extending technological support by establishing 179 nursery ponds in the State to produce 2.1 fingerlings during past two years, has decided to extend the benefit to more areas. At present, the project is covered in Visakhapatnam, East Godavari, Srikakulam, Vizianagaram, Anantapur and Kurnool districts by helping fishermen to develop 179 ponds in an area of 15,000 acres in 190 villages to raise fingerlings and growing adult fish for sale in the market. The number of beneficiaries which is now 7,000 families would be raised to two lakh by 2020.
